    Tolaga Bay Wharf (pier), North Island, New Zealand

    Scanned silver print from a 4x5 negative.

    For those who like details...

    Taken on 1 December 1986 while on a 5.5 month bicycle tour
    Gowland 4x5 PocketView w/ Caltar 150/5.6 and a 25A (red) filter
    Kodak Royal Pan at rated ASA
    5 seconds at f64 -- developed normally
